  1. Get Your Rate – Eligibility Inquiry

During the “Get Your Rate” process, we may conduct an eligibility inquiry (also known as a “soft credit pull”) through one of the credit reporting agencies (i.e. Experian, TransUnion or Equifax). This inquiry should not affect your credit score. By clicking the “Get Your Rate” button on the Site, you have provided us with specific written instructions under the Fair Credit Reporting Act. Those instructions authorize us to obtain certain information from your personal credit profile and/or other information from consumer reporting agencies. Upon your request, we will inform you of the name and address of any consumer reporting agency from which we obtained your consumer report.

  1. Complete Application & Promissory Note – Credit Inquiry

When you submit your loan application online, we may conduct a credit inquiry (also known as a “hard credit pull” or “hard credit inquiry”), a standard step in most loan applications. This inquiry will be recorded on your credit history and may impact your credit score. By completing and clicking “Submit Loan Application” and/or electronically signing the Application & Promissory Note on the Site, you have provided us with written instructions under the Fair Credit Reporting Act. These instructions authorize us to obtain information from your personal credit profile and/or other information from through one of the credit reporting agencies (i.e. Experian, TransUnion or Equifax). Upon your request, we will inform you of the name and address of any consumer reporting agency from which we obtained your consumer report.

  1. Free Credit Report

You have the right under the Fair Credit Reporting Act to receive one free credit report from each of the three U.S. national credit reporting agencies (Experian, Equifax, and TransUnion) during any 12-month period. Please visit each company’s website to obtain a free credit report from ExperianEquifax or TransUnion. You may also be able to receive free credit reports as permitted by state law. We recommend that you contact your state or local consumer protection agency or state attorney general to learn more about your rights in your particular state.
